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

From the 1930s until the 1970s, asbestos was extensively employed in building materials. It was used as insulation for pipes, fireproofing products, cements and plasters, car brakes, and more. Exposure to this dangerous substance can cause serious medical conditions, such as mesothelioma and other respiratory diseases.

A qualified New York m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ims in obtaining comp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is crucial to select the right lawyer when filing this type of claim.

Look for a Specialist

When asbestos is extracted and processed the tiny fibers break up easily and can be breathed in. This can cause mesothelioma, lung cancer, and asbestosis. People who handle asbestos directly are more at risk, but anyone can inhale asbestos. This kind of exposure, also known as secondary exposure can affect anyone who is around the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This includes relatives that wash the uniform of the worker, as well as any other person living in the same house. This is also a possibility in military bases and on ships where workers wear the same clothing for long periods of time.

Asbestos can be a problem for those who work in shipyards, construction, mills, as well as insulation, mining and other industries. This was especially true in the United States from the 1950s until the 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os claim when the old buildings were remodeled or demolished, and when damaged building materials. Even today, demolition and remodeling in older buildings could release asbestos into the air.

It can be a long period of time between exposure to asbestos and the mesothelioma onset symptoms or other symptoms. It is therefore important to consult a doctor in the event that you have been exposed to asbestos or think you may be suffering from any of the ailments that are associated with asbestos.

Your doctor will take a listen to your lungs and ask about any work history that may have involved asbestos. If they suspect that you suffer from an asbestos-related disease, they may refer you to a specialist for further tests. Asbestos-related illnesses can be detected through chest X-rays or CT scans. However, they might not be detected in these tests.

These conditions can affect the lungs, heart and abdomen. It is r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

Some experts believe that the best way to protect yourself from asbestos exposure is to avoid all kinds of dust and to never smoke or work in any industry that might use it. Other experts believe that this is impossible and that individuals should be examined regularly for symptoms of asbestos-related diseases.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will take your health records and employment records in order to establish a timeline for your asbestos exposure. They will then construct your case by accumulating evidence that proves that you were exposed to asbestos and the exposure harmed you. They will then send each defendant a copy of your complaint and they will be given 30 days to respond. The defendants will usually deny responsibility and might even attempt to blame someone else. You require a skilled team of lawyers to deal with these denials.

Once they have all the necessary documents, your attorney will start the asbestos lawsuit. They will file the lawsuit in the state court that is the most suitable for your situation. During this time, the attorneys will gather evidence and conduct discovery in which they exchange information with the opposing party about the case. They will also argue on your behalf at trial if you decide to go to trial. However, the majority of cases settle through an asbestos settlement (simply click Design 24).

Asbestos litigation is distinct from other personal injury cases and that's why it's important to hire mesothelioma specialists. They have access to a database that shows patients what specific asbestos-related products they used during their work. This helps patients to identify the products the cause of their exposure.

They also know which companies are responsible for your exposure. This includes the manufacturers of asbestos-containing items that you handled, and the owners of buildings containing as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.
